The Crypto Fear and Greed Index drops to 12, and the market is in extreme fear

Gate News message, April 13. According to Alternative.me data, today the Crypto Fear and Greed Index is 12, down further from yesterday’s 16, with the market in an “extreme fear” state. This index evaluates market sentiment across multiple dimensions, including volatility, market trading volume, social media, market surveys, Bitcoin’s share of the overall market, and Google Trends keyword analysis. The lower the number, the greater the level of fear.
